The makefile in v4l-dvb/v4l does not install all modules when calling "make
install". For example videodev is missing. This is the result of a wrong
include order for this case.
the order is as follows:
1. makefile sources Make.config
2. Make.config decides which modules to use based on kernel-version variables
(SUBLEVEL, PATCHLEVEL, ...) which are not set at this point.
3. Then makefile sources either file from kernel or .version to set version
variables.
In some way point 3 has to be moved before point 1, but this could bring other
problems.
